Handover — Vexler partner SFTP drop

Ownership moves to you today. Drop runs hourly from Vexler's end into the intake bucket via the relay host. Watch for zero-byte files; their exporter flakes on Mondays. Creds live in the ops vault, path noted in the runbook. Vault auto-seals after 48h idle. Support escalations go to the on-call rotation, not me. If the vault is sealed when you need it, unseal with the recovery passphrase below.

recovery phrase for tadug-fafof: zorwyn-kasion

**Vendor note: Inkmill markdown pipeline**

Rendering for Parchway docs is outsourced to Inkmill under an annual contract, renewing each March. They handle sanitization and PDF export; we own the upload queue. SLA: 4-hour response on rendering failures. Escalate only after two failed retries. Their support desk is reachable at the address below.

billing contact of hahaf-baguf = zorael.tammir.jorius@sivrelhq.internal

Subject: Handover — report export timezones

Hey Marit,

Quick handover before I'm off. Quillhawk exports now normalize everything to UTC before plugins see it, so external authors shouldn't do their own offset math anymore. Docs are updated in the plugin portal. One thing left: new export bundles must be signed before publishing, so here's the signing key you'll need.

deploy key for kajof-fajop: bky6_gDHw9Q